Lloyd Group Logo

Lloyd Group

Locations: 263 W 38th St New York, NY 10018, US

Company Size: 100 - 200

Industry: IT Services and IT Consulting

Company Website

AI Description

drawer
  • Richard MCclay profile image

    Master Plumber at Lloyd

  • Cindy Jadon profile image

    Mortgage Banker at Lloyd

  • Momio Lola profile image

    lol i Lloyd

  • anna jones profile image

    business management

  • Arshad Promoter profile image

    Engineer at Lloyd

  • Sandy Brown profile image

    Cyber Security and Risk Management Analyst at The Lloyd Group

Showing 1 to 7 of 104 results